    I am interested in ordering the dv6700t special edition. But one complaint I have noticed on various forums is fan noise. I am not interested in playing games, but I would watch an occasional movie. I was wondering if going with integrated x3100 graphics would be quieter than the discrete 8400M GS. The $50 upgrade to the 8400M looks like a good deal, but not if it means a louder notebook. What are your experiences? I am guessing you get one or the other and cannot remove the 8400M like in a desktop PC.

    The x3100 would definately be cooler but the fan noise will be the same. Chances are the fans will go on less with a integrated card.

    Its not just the GPU that makes heat. GPU and CPU share the same fan. If one of them is getting too hot then the fans will go on
